Grilled Scallop, Fennel & Orange Kabobs with Arugula Pesto
Prep Time20 Minutes
Servings4
Cook Time6 Minutes
Calories349
Ingredients
1/2 cup Shelled Walnuts
1 Garlic Clove, coarsely chopped
1/2 cup Packed Baby Arugula
1/4 cup Extra Virgin Olive Oil
1 1/2 Tbs Fresh Lemon Juice
1 Tbs Nutritional Yeast
1 1/4 lbs Fresh Dry Large Sea Scallops, patted dry
2 Medium Oranges, quartered, then cut into ½-inch-thick wedges
1 Bulb Fennel, cut into 1-inch pieces
Directions

1. Prepare outdoor grill for direct grilling over medium-high heat. Soak 8 (10-inch) wooden skewers in water 20 minutes.

 

2. In large skillet, toast walnuts over medium heat 5 minutes or until lightly browned, stirring frequently; transfer to plate to cool.

 

3. In food processor, purée garlic, arugula, oil, lemon juice, nutritional yeast and walnuts. Makes about ½ cup.

 

4. Alternately thread scallops, oranges and fennel onto skewers; spray with cooking spray and sprinkle with salt and pepper to taste. Place skewers on hot grill rack; cover and cook 6 minutes or until internal temperature of scallops reaches 145°, turning once. Serve with Arugula Pesto.

 

Nutritional Information
  • 24 g Fat
  • 3 g Saturated fat
  • 29 mg Cholesterol
  • 506 mg Sodium
  • 19 g Carbohydrates
  • 5 g Fiber
  • 9 g Sugars
  • 0 g Added sugars
  • 18 g Protein
